Transitioning to Taste of the Wild pet Food

When switching to Taste of the Wild Food, we recommend a gradual transition over 7-10 days to avoid any potential digestive upset in sensitive pets. Add a small amount of the new Food to the dog's previous Food diet, increase the amount of the new Food and decrease the amount of the previous Food until the transition is complete.

American Association of Feed Control Officials (AAFCO)

Taste of the Wild's Old Prairie dog product recipe with roasted bison meat and roasted venison meat is designed to meet the nutritional levels set by the American Association of Feed Control Officials for the Food nutrient profile for dogs of all life stages, including growth of large dogs (70 pounds or more as an adult dog).
